> On 11/14/23 23:31, Wenchao Hao wrote:
> > This issue is reported by smatch, get_quota_realm() might return
> > ERR_PTR, so we should using IS_ERR_OR_NULL here to check the return
> > value.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Wenchao Hao <haowenchao2@...wei.com>
> > ---
> >   fs/ceph/quota.c | 2 +-
> >   1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
> >
> > diff --git a/fs/ceph/quota.c b/fs/ceph/quota.c
> > index 9d36c3532de1..c4b2929c6a83 100644
> > --- a/fs/ceph/quota.c
> > +++ b/fs/ceph/quota.c
> > @@ -495,7 +495,7 @@ bool ceph_quota_update_statfs(struct ceph_fs_client *fsc, struct kstatfs *buf)
> >       realm = get_quota_realm(mdsc, d_inode(fsc->sb->s_root),
> >                               QUOTA_GET_MAX_BYTES, true);
> >       up_read(&mdsc->snap_rwsem);
> > -     if (!realm)
> > +     if (IS_ERR_OR_NULL(realm))
> >               return false;
> >
> >       spin_lock(&realm->inodes_with_caps_lock);
>
> Good catch.
>
> Reviewed-by: Xiubo Li <xiubli@...hat.com>
>
> We should CC the stable mail list.

Hi Xiubo,

What exactly is being fixed here?  get_quota_realm() is called with
retry=true, which means that no errors can be returned -- EAGAIN, the
only error that get_quota_realm() can otherwise generate, would be
handled internally by retrying.

Am I missing something that makes this qualify for stable?
